Men’s performance supplements often come in the form of pills, capsules, or powders. These supplements can include a variety of ingredients designed to boost stamina, increase muscle mass, enhance recovery, and improve overall vitality. Common ingredients found in these products include creatine, protein, amino acids, and vitamins tailored to men’s health. The primary advantage of these supplements is their ability to deliver potent doses of specific nutrients directly to the body. For instance, many men turn to protein powders after workouts to boost muscle recovery and growth, while others may seek out pre-workout formulas for an immediate energy boost.
On the other hand, transdermal patches offer a different approach to supplementation. These patches are designed to be applied to the skin, where they deliver active ingredients directly into the bloodstream over a sustained period. This method bypasses the digestive system, which can enhance bioavailability and effectiveness. The transdermal route has gained traction due to its convenience—users can simply apply a patch and go about their day without worrying about remembering to take multiple pills or mixes. One of the key differences between these two methods is absorption. While oral supplements can be subject to factors such as stomach acid and digestive enzymes that may affect their efficacy, transdermal patches allow for more direct delivery of nutrients. This is particularly beneficial for individuals who may have digestive issues or those who need a more consistent level of nutrients over time. Patches can provide a steady release of ingredients, minimizing peaks and valleys that can occur with oral supplements.
